Transaction 2577e7f95e6ffb900dd64ff05d70822da302343f408cef264eebd04075013768

1 Input
2 Outputs
  • 2577e7f95e6ffb900dd64ff05d70822da302343f408cef264eebd04075013768:0
  • value  8596800
    address  bc1qek75cm33y40a8g4nzcwy5p8nh5ek9tlp56906k
  • 2577e7f95e6ffb900dd64ff05d70822da302343f408cef264eebd04075013768:1
  • value  7319800
    address  1FB9XHYH2LAptduWyTs5JRCgmuJAhYagA2